Deception (noun) Definition, Meaning & Examples
Deception (noun) Definition, Meaning & Examples
Admin
noun
the act of
deceiving
; the state of being
deceived
.
something that
deceives
or is intended to
deceive
; fraud; artifice.
noun
the act of deceiving or the state of being deceived
something that deceives; trick
